Is it possible to use a compiler directive to control if a particular delegate is implemented?

For example, in the following code, I only want to include a library if we’re a constant is defined:

#ifdef kShouldLoadFromCSV
#import "CHCSVParser.h"
#endif

@interface MyAppDelegate : NSObject <UIApplicationDelegate, UITabBarControllerDelegate, CHCSVParserDelegate>{

If kShouldLoadFromCSV is undefined, I don’t want to implement CHCSVParserDelegate. I’ve tried sticking the compile directive in the interface declaration, but that didn’t work.

Is there a way to do this?

    You could do this:

    #if kShouldLoadFromCSV
        @interface MyAppDelegate : NSObject <UIApplicationDelegate, UITabBarControllerDelegate, CHCSVParserDelegate>{
    #else
        @interface MyAppDelegate : NSObject <UIApplicationDelegate, UITabBarControllerDelegate>{
    #endif
    

    Or if you wish, maybe harder to read, a matter of taste:

        @interface MyAppDelegate : NSObject <UIApplicationDelegate, UITabBarControllerDelegate
    #if kShouldLoadFromCSV
          , CHCSVParserDelegate
    #endif
    >{
    

    You have to remember that the preprocessor isn’t syntax aware, it will just affect the input of the compiler.
